Xeon D-1567 vs Xeon E-2126G Technical Specifications
Side-by-side specs, architecture details, clocks, memory, power, and platform differences.

Xeon D-1567
The Xeon D-1567 is manufactured by Intel. It was released in 24 February 2016 (9 years ago). It is based on the Broadwell (2015−2019) architecture. It features 12 cores and 24 threads. Base frequency is 2.1 GHz, with boost up to 2.7 GHz. L3 cache: 1.5 MB (per core). L2 cache: 256K (per core). Built on 14 nm process technology. Socket: FCBGA1667. Thermal design power (TDP): 65 Watt. Memory support: DDR4, DDR3. Passmark benchmark score: 10,447 points. Launch price was $1,069.

Xeon E-2126G
The Xeon E-2126G is manufactured by Intel. It was released in 12 July 2018 (7 years ago). It is based on the Coffee Lake-S WS (2018−2019) architecture. It features 6 cores and 6 threads. Base frequency is 3.3 GHz, with boost up to 4.5 GHz. L3 cache: 12 MB (total). L2 cache: 256 kB (per core). Built on 14 nm process technology. Socket: LGA1151. Thermal design power (TDP): 80 Watt. Memory support: DDR4-2666. Passmark benchmark score: 10,437 points. Launch price was $255.
Processing Power
The Xeon D-1567 packs 12 cores / 24 threads, while the Xeon E-2126G offers 6 cores / 6 threads — the Xeon D-1567 has 6 more cores. Boost clocks reach 2.7 GHz on the Xeon D-1567 versus 4.5 GHz on the Xeon E-2126G — a 50% clock advantage for the Xeon E-2126G (base: 2.1 GHz vs 3.3 GHz). The Xeon D-1567 uses the Broadwell (2015−2019) architecture (14 nm), while the Xeon E-2126G uses Coffee Lake-S WS (2018−2019) (14 nm). In PassMark, the Xeon D-1567 scores 10,447 against the Xeon E-2126G's 10,437 — a 0.1% lead for the Xeon D-1567. L3 cache: 1.5 MB (per core) on the Xeon D-1567 vs 12 MB (total) on the Xeon E-2126G.
